WebA Collective Investment Scheme is an investment scheme where various individuals come together and pool their money in order to invest their whole fund collection in a particular asset. The returns and profits arising from this investment would be shared as per the agreement finalised amongst the investors prior to the act. Webinvestment companies do not come within the definition of “managed investment scheme” under the Corporations Act 2001. Such companies are regulated as any other company, rather than as a CIS. The definition of “managed investment scheme” does not mandate any particular structure – it may be trust or contract based. WebWhat is a Collective Investment Scheme (CIS)?
